Biography of Angelina Jolie
Angelina Jolie was born in Los Angeles, California, to actors Jon Voight and Marcheline Bertrand. She was raised in a creative environment, which shaped her interest in acting from a young age. After facing various challenges in her youth, including her parents' divorce, she pursued acting and made her film debut in "Lookin' to Get Out" (1982).

Career Highlights
Angelina Jolie's career is marked by numerous accolades and achievements. She won an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ress for her role in "Girl, Interrupted" and received critical acclaim for her performances in films such as "A Mighty Heart" and "Changeling." Jolie was also known for her work behind the camera, directing films like "Unbroken" and "First They Killed My Father."

Humanitarian Work
Beyond her film career, Angelina Jolie was a dedicated humanitarian. She served as a Goodwill Ambassador and later as a Special Envoy for the United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R). Her advocacy for refugees and displaced persons led her to visit over 60 countries, bringing global attention to the plight of the vulnerable.
Key Initiatives
- Founding the Maddox Jolie-Pitt Foundation
- Establishing the Preventing Sexual Violence in Conflict Initiative
- Advocating for education and healthcare for children in conflict zones
